Record High Gas Prices Amid Memorial Day Weekend Travel

(77WABC) — As Americans kick off the unofficial start of Summer, motorists face record high gas prices with inflation at a 40 year high under the Biden administration.

According to AAA, the national average is $4.60 a gallon — the highest recorded average ever. In California, a gallon of gas has skyrocket to as much $7.25 at at least nine stations — the same as minimum wage.

Despite pain at the pumps, AAA forecasts that 39 million people will travel more than 50 miles from their homes this holiday weekend. That’s an 8% jump from last year when gas was about $3 a gallon on average.
